## Perchstand Watchdog Environments

The Perchstand kiosk watchdog runs in three flavors: dev (restarts are logged, never executed), staging (real restarts, fake kiosks), and prod (the real deal at the Larkmoor sites). Release order is always dev → staging → prod, with a day of soak in staging minimum. Prod rollouts go through the usual sign-off. The staging environment currently boots with these values.

service settings:
[briius]
port = 3000
region = outer-1
host = briius.zarqeldyn.internal
team = wenael
timeout_ms = 2000
retries = 5

Subject: Divestiture of the Marrowfield Packaging Unit

Colleagues,

After careful evaluation, we have signed a letter of intent to sell the Marrowfield packaging unit to Tresk Holdings. The unit has been profitable but sits outside our core logistics strategy, and the proceeds strengthen our balance sheet ahead of next year's expansion. Customer contracts transfer intact; affected staff receive offers from the buyer. Sales leads should route any client questions to Priya Oldenvik's transition desk. The strategic reasoning is set out below.

confidential, kagup-bafog: Fraaxax Group is in early talks to buy Soroxox Group for about $343.8 million. The Olidor launch date is June 14, and nothing goes to the press before then. Legal wants the Aldmirek Logistics term sheet signed before July 23.

## Further reading

Vantpost is a metrics-aggregation sidecar. It scrapes local endpoints, batches, and forwards over mTLS to the Corrix collector. No payload inspection; labels are allowlisted at build time. Ports are bound to loopback only. Credentials rotate via the host agent, never baked into the image. Threat model, data-flow diagram, and the last review's findings are on the internal page below.

wiki page, fajof-tajef: https://vault.tolvaqio.corp/board/pipeline/pages/ticket/c20d7f984bcc9e12

## Ownership

The seat-map renderer for the Gilded Finch Theatre is maintained as part of the Stagelight platform. It handles tiered pricing overlays, accessibility seat flags, and the balcony curvature projection. Future maintainers should note the projection math lives in a single module and is deliberately dependency-free; keep it that way. Rendering bugs and layout-data schema changes are owned by one person:

signatory, bajof-yahif: Zorael Wenael